GDR swimming championships 1970
The GDR swimming championships were held for the 21st time in 1970 and took place from July 8th to 12th in Brandenburg an der Havel in the Volksbad am Marienberg , where the champions were determined on 29 courses (15 men / 14 women). The competition also served as a qualifying competition for the 1970 European Championships in Barcelona . With seven titles, SC DHfK Leipzig was the most successful team and Roland Matthes from SC Turbine Erfurt , who won four individual titles, was just like Lutz Unger from SC Dynamo Berlin (2 in individual and 2 in relay) the most successful athlete in these championships.
The sporting highlights of the championships were the new GDR records of Roland Matthes over 200 meters medley and Brigitte Schuchardt over 200 meters chest. Barbara Hofmeister set the GDR record over 100 meters back. Furthermore, the men's relay from SC Dynamo Berlin achieved a new GDR record for club relay over the 4 × 200 meter freestyle.
